Band 3 Occupational Therapy Support Worker - Bristol

This is an exciting opportunity to be part of inpatient open rehabilitation ward in a community setting, alongside our ward OT. The successful candidate will work alongside our ward OT, as well as the broader MDT. The teams focus is to consolidate and develop a focused rehabilitation programme for the service users on the ward.

Right to Work in the UK This position is not eligible for Skilled Worker visa sponsorship. Applicants must already hold the legal right to work in the UK at the time of application, as the organisation is unable to support sponsorship for this post.


Main duties of the job

The person we recruit will need to have a broad knowledge of activity of daily living skills and an interest in a variety of activities. The team deliver a comprehensive rehabilitation programme, activities to inspire, encourage and support individuals who have mental health problems on their journey of rehabilitation and recovery. As part of the team you will plan and deliver 1:1 or group sessions under the supervision of our occupational therapists within the hospital, service users homes, and the local community.

The applicant should be an effective communicator who enjoys working alongside people and helping them achieve their goals. They should also be a confident with cooking skills and interests in other practical and creative activities. They will need experience of working with people with enduring mental health needs, neurodiversity and learning difficulties.

The applicant will need to support with observations and engagement tasks on occasions.

The applicant may also need to support service users to attend local appointments.

Job responsibilities

Clinical Practice

1. Work in a collaborative and cooperative manner with service users, their families/carers and other health and social care professionals. Recognise and respect their involvement in the planning and delivery of care.
2. Assist in the maintenance of a safe therapeutic environment beneficial to the needs of the service users, relatives carers and others.
3. Contribute to the team approach, providing accurate and relevant feedback to registered staff: participate in team discussions and meetings regarding care of service users.
4. Develop a therapeutic relationship with service users to encourage and maximise their interest and participation in therapeutic activity.
5. Organise day to day activities for groups and individual therapy programmes including occasional assessment, planning, implementation, and evaluation under the supervision of the mental health professionals.
6. Play a part in preparation of safety assessments and personal wellbeing plans,

Education & Health Promotion

1. To keep up to date with changing practices and attend relevant training appropriate to the role as directed.
2. Promote positive attitudes towards mental health.
3. Attend regular statutory training and updates.
4. Participate in appraisal and supervision processes from ward OT.
5. Contribute to the learning environment of staff/students Finance and Workforce.
6. To play a role in making best use of available workforce and material resources and contributing to provision of best therapy possible.
7. Follow Trust and Service Policies relating to the security of the building/clients, to ensure safe practice and protection of clients, staff, visitors and members of the general public.
8. Play a part in the service provision that is both safe and therapeutic within span of knowledge.
9. Record Keeping and Administration.
10. To maintain standards of record keeping and associated administration in accordance with AWP Trust Policy and local joint arrangements and professional guidelines. This will include the upkeep of contemporaneous, chronological and accurate mental health records in accordance with relevant COT Guidelines and Trust Policy.
